#include <windows.h>
#include <ShellWidget/ShellWidgetCommon.h>
#include <ShellWidget/UiWidget.h>
宏定义 | |
#define | SHELL_WIDGET_FREE_ID_COUNT (0xEFFF-0xB000) |
#define | SHELL_WIDGET_MAX_FREE_ID 0xEFFF |
Shell Widget的控件的ID最大值(ID值从0xEFFF~0xB000). | |
#define | SHELL_WIDGET_MIN_FREE_ID 0xB000 |
Shell Widget的控件的ID最小值(ID值从0xEFFF~0xB000). | |
函数 | |
SHELLWIDGET_API HMODULE | GetShellResLib () |
获得ShellRes.dll资源句柄 | |
SHELLWIDGET_API UINT | SW_GetFreeID () |
SHELLWIDGET_API void | SW_ReleaseID (int nID) |
释放ID,使它空闲 |
#define SHELL_WIDGET_FREE_ID_COUNT (0xEFFF-0xB000) |
#define SHELL_WIDGET_MAX_FREE_ID 0xEFFF |
Shell Widget的控件的ID最大值(ID值从0xEFFF~0xB000).
#define SHELL_WIDGET_MIN_FREE_ID 0xB000 |
Shell Widget的控件的ID最小值(ID值从0xEFFF~0xB000).
SHELLWIDGET_API HMODULE GetShellResLib | ( | ) |
获得ShellRes.dll资源句柄
SHELLWIDGET_API UINT SW_GetFreeID | ( | ) |
获得空闲的控件ID Widget的控件ID请使用此函数来获得设置,以避免ID冲突 获得的ID必须在不使用时调用SW_ReleaseID(id)进行释放
SHELLWIDGET_API void SW_ReleaseID | ( | int | nID | ) |
释放ID,使它空闲